Top 5 Music and Podcasts iOS Apps in Turkey: Q1 2024 Performance
Explore the performance metrics of the top 5 music and podcast apps on iOS in Turkey for Q1 2024,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2024, the music and podcast apps on iOS in Turkey showed a dynamic performance. Here's a closer look at the top 5 apps based on their weekly downloads, revenue, and active users, according to Sensor Tower data.
YouTube Music from Google saw a strong performance in Q1 2024. Weekly revenue peaked at approximately $42.4K in the last week of February. Downloads remained relatively stable, averaging around 23K per week. The app maintained a high level of engagement, with weekly active users increasing from 3.37M at the start of January to 3.54M by the end of March.
fizy – Music & Video experienced a gradual decline in revenue, starting the quarter with $3.3K and ending with $1.6K. Weekly downloads showed a slight decrease, fluctuating between 4.1K and 4.9K. Active users remained steady, hovering around 37K to 38K throughout the quarter.
Deezer: Music Player, Podcast from DEEZER SA faced a downward trend in both revenue and active users. Weekly revenue dropped from $2.1K in early January to $764 by the end of March. Downloads were consistent, averaging around 1K per week. Active users saw a minor decline, from 16.3K to 15K over the quarter.
Meet The Music: Chat & Dating had a modest performance in revenue, starting at $1.1K and ending at $756. Downloads were low, averaging around 100 per week, and there was no data available for active users.
MYT Music Streaming and Videos by Ali Bougarfaoui showed a declining trend in revenue, from $1.1K to $322. Downloads were more stable, with a weekly average of around 14K. Active users remained consistent, starting the quarter at 108K and ending at 107K.
